An unusual antique five-light Spanish Revival chandelier by Empire Lighting, patented c. 1923. The chandelier, salvaged out of a home in Indianapolis, IN, begins with an elegant canopy, coming down in a short rod and chain to an arched finial atop an urn; the urn is ornamented with an unusual grooved geometric design and polychrome accents in red and green, a design that continues throughout the fixture. Downward facing bobeches suspend from the perimeter of the lamp body, each holding an exposed bulb surrounded by a curtain of sparkling “icicle” prisms. This bronze over pewter light fixture is in excellent condition, with a small chip on one of the bobeches that does not detract from its beauty (as pictured). It has been professionally rewired and comes with all the necessary attachments for modern installation. The chandelier body measures 19″ wide and 21” tall, and the fixture is 37-3/4″ long overall.
